The best routes with panoramic views in Adeje

Adeje is one of the main tourist municipalities of Tenerife and is visited by thousands of tourists every year. Its beaches, its mountains and its historical and cultural heritage make it attractive to a very varied audience. But to get to know the space well, it is necessary to enter it and explore it, so there is nothing better to do some of the best Tenerife trails.

There are many and varied options. From walks in the middle of the mountains or along the most paradisiacal beaches of the Island, in the middle of the city or along routes that run through the old agricultural areas. But if there is one thing that will surprise you in all of them, it is their magnificent panoramic views.

Here we offer you some of the top walking trails of Adeje with panoramic views. Take out your camera and take a memory for a lifetime.

If you want to enjoy breathtaking views along the Adejera coast, there is nothing better than taking a route between Costa Adeje and Playa de Las Américas, in Arona, a neighboring municipality where you will also find good bathing areas.

This experience can be very different if you do it in winter or summer, since you will be able to find different tourist profiles and more or less crowded beaches. But, without a doubt, doing the route in the afternoon will also allow you to enjoy a great sunset.

We suggest that you start your way in Costa Adejegoing through the Duque, Fañabé and Torviscas beaches, among others, until reaching Las Américas. A whole spectacle of beaches that will make you feel in paradise.

Way of the Virgin

The following path is special. Not only because it is one of those with the longest history, but also because its views will surprise you. Its about Way of the Virgin of adejea place where the Virgin of the Incarnation -hence that formerly carried his name- from La Enramada to the Hermitage of Santa Úrsula of the municipality to protect it from pirate attacks in the 16th century.

This route starts from El Portón towards the coast and ends at the old hermitage of La Enramada, currently known as Old Hermitage of San Sebastian. Throughout the journey, not only will you be able to see the natural landscape through which you walk, but in the distance you can see a panoramic view of the coast, with the most popular tourist areas and the most modern hotel buildings.

Ifonche-Barranco del Infierno

The route from Ifonche to Barranco del Infierno It has an approximate distance of about four kilometers and is of moderate difficulty. The Ifonche Protected Landscape is characterized by its agricultural presence. Its protection is given by being a rural landscape with buildings of Canarian architecture, terraced agricultural plots of great scenic beauty and where areas transformed by human activities coexist with small natural redoubts.

All this makes the views along this route very special. But, in addition, the path leads to the Barranco del Infierno, one of the most popular for hiking on the island.

During the journey you will be able to observe various species of flora and fauna, as well as delight yourself with the wonderful views of the landscape.
